UALL activities include a series of seminars and a major Annual Conference which attracts a wide constituency from the UK and overseas. The conference addresses concepts, research, policy and practice in university lifelong learning through keynote addresses, seminars and workshops and typically includes addresses from ministers and government officers. Other events are arranged throughout the year, with the practitioner networks organising their own seminar programmes.
